Question 794926: James and Lin got married and got new jobs in Chicago. Lin earns $3400 more per year than James. Together they earn $82,300. How much do each of them earn per year?

x + x + 3400 = 82300
subtract 3400 from both sides
- 3400 - 3400
x + x = 78900
combine like terms
2x = 78900
divide both sides by 2
James is x = $39450
Lin is x + 3400 = $42850
